As promised in my last post to NavList, I have now written a post on my blog at www.sextantbook.com . Go to the category "Blunders" and find "Incorrect assembly of SNO-T shades". It tells you step by step how to assemble them correctly. Preceding it is a post about Tamaya's incorrect assembly of a collimating rising piece.
For owners of older C Plath sextants who are infuriated by their inability to adjust the friction of the shades, because they cannot obtain the ridiculous adjusting tool with _three_ pins, I have also today written a post on how you or your friendly local model engineer can make your own. Look under the category "C Plath sextants".
